Summary/Abstract: The sporting activity in Sinaia and its surroundings began during the second half of the XIX-th century - these are walks in the mountains. The construction of the Palace of Peleş has given a great boost to the sports actions which receive in the course of time an organized character, an important role returning to the members of the royal family. Each year, except for the period of the First World War, Sinaia took place sports competitions as much during the winter as the summer. Similarly, a growing amplitude took the motorsports, Sinaia occupying an important place in motor racing, motorcycles and bicycles. The generous setting offered by the mountains of Bucegi has resulted in the development of mountain tourism
